Abstract: Objective:To observe the influence of acupuncture-moxibustion treatment on patients with mild cognition disorder.Methods:Sixty patients with mild cognition disorder were randomly divided into a treatment group and a control group,with 30 cases in each group.Acupuncture-moxibustion treatment was used in the treatment group,while Western medicine was taken by the patients in the control group.The differences of intra-group and inter-group comparisons were assessed by 3 measurement scales including Mini-mental State Examination (MMSE),Activity of Daily Living (ADL) and Montreal Cognitive Assessment (MoCA).Results:After treatment,the MMSE,MoCA and ADL scores of both groups were higher than those before treatment (P<0.05).The MMSE,MoCA and ADL scores of the treatment group have more noticeable improvement than those of the control group (P<0.05).Conclusion:Acupuncture-moxibustion treatment can effectively improve cognitive function of the patients with mild cognitive impairment.
